Does any one have experience on using pro/engineer routed system designer module? Can you tell me what it is used for? does it really enhance our design skill? can you suggest any document related to this module?

Routed Systems Designer (RSDesigner) is a multi-purpose diagramming
package that can be used to produce wiring/electrical/P&ID and
block diagrams. The tool itself is very powerful and can produce
diagrams to whatever standards you use. It maintains the connectivity
between objects and diagram object can have all sorts of extra data
applied to them.



The power then comes from the fact that you can export the design data
to Pro/Cabling or Pro/Piping to save you having to type it all in again
- giving you a complete design path.



I have worked with quite a few companies that are using this process
and it makes life so much easier for them because it saves time and is
more accurate.



RSD can also be expanded to have design rule checks set up that you can use to maintain the correctness of the design.

Is RSDesigner a standalone package or it must run in pro/e evironment?


Also, Thanks for your link.These information's so great.


NDK
 
RSD is standalone but it integrates with ProE in such a way that you use this for pro/piping and pro/cabling.
